Do not submit to directory sites!!! You'll lose some traffic!

I started w/ PR 0 but now it's at PR 1 (yeah, still long way to go). I did this by submitting to 100+ directory sites (used some auto submit program). Now... I regret doing this... why? most corporate office blocked my site!!! (yes..even at my work!). I imagine this happened cuz I submitted to some entertainment directory!... now my # of hits has decreased 30%.. it sux~~ So learn my lesson and don't submit to any directory site! I understand it depends on your audience.. for me it's day time office people.
